VOXXEL.column.05
3D-printed media, copper plating, and custom patina
Height: 2 meters
The sculpture’s journey begins in a digital landscape, shaped through command-line operations, freeform drawing, and controlled TNT-based destruction.
These virtual voxel structures are then translated into physical objects using 3D printing.
VOXXEL.column.05 undergoes extensive material experimentation—including copper plating and meticulous patination.
The final column stands as a monument to material transformation, merging the blocky aesthetics of code with the weathered, timeless feel of an ancient artifact.

VOXXEL.column
Voxel-like forms — reminiscent of ancient cultural glyphs or mechanical components — meander and interlock to form a labyrinthine column. The stacked layers pulse rhythmically between crisp, recognizable structure and degraded chaos, as vibrant turquoise and earthy rust patinas emerge across the surfaces.
Engineered with tectonic precision yet softened by natural oxidation, each column feels both archaic and futuristic — a digital totem that has begun to weather and transform, blurring the boundary between code and living matter.
